Gabe, PUSHER is actually Drive‘s Nicholas Winding Refn’s first film, and first part of a trilogy of PUSHER films he did, and for some reason someone decided to remake it, which is what this trailer is for.
The PUSHER trilogy is pretty top notch though. I don’t know about this remake, but if you have a chance I would recommend checking them out. For a while the first one was on Netflix Instant.
I just checked, and only the 3rd one is available streaming, for some reason. Hopefully it’s like The Wire, and I can just start from anywhere.
You really can. All three films focus on separate characters in the same world of the drug trade, at completely different points in their lives. The third one focuses on a character who had supporting roles in the first two films.

I have a lot of problems with the Abraham Lincoln Vampire Hunter movie, but I am sad to admit that I actually shouted “WHAT” at the trailer when it showed the National Mall in DC. The Washington Monument wasn’t completed during Lincoln’s lifetime, but they have it in the trailer.
